Produktbeschreibung
The first time Brad Sureshot met Tom Ole Tunda he looked up. And up. And up. And then he looked up some more. After Brad was done looking up, he could only say one word. The word was "Wow." That's what most kids said the first time they met Tom, the tall newcomer to the Courtside Sparks, boys' basketball team. Brad, the son of two coaches and self-confessed "basketball brain," seemed happiest of all because the smiling, soft-spoken Tom just might be the one to lead the boys to their first championship. But while practicing in the gym one day, suddenly Tom disappears. The only clues are a broken shoelace, a magazine, and a scent that "smells like summer." Although he is puzzled, Brad is determined to find his friend as he follows a trail which leads from his small town deep into the heart of Africa. Join Brad, his friends Chris, Harvey, Ursula, and his eccentric Aunt Aggie as they try to put together the clues which will help them discover where and who Tom really is. As an added bonus, after each chapter you will find instructions on basketball skills both boys and girls can enjoy.
Autorenporträt
SHIRLEY RUSSAK WACHTEL is best known for her historical fiction novels, A Castle in Brooklyn (Little A) and The Baker of Lost Memories (Little A). Her children's books include Where is Emmy, Zoey and the Purple Elephant, The Eight Days of Hanukkah, What Would I Be, and an interactive detective series for young readers. Shirley is a retired professor of English at a college in central New Jersey, where she lives with her husband, Arthur. She is the mother of three grown sons and has three granddaughters, Zoey, Emmy, and the adorable and well-behaved Stella!KELLY MICHELLE MEMBRENO is a Salvadoran-American college student studying illustration. She is the youngest of five siblings, and it was her elder brother who taught her how to draw. With the support of her family and friends, she continued to draw and develop her skills. Through her studies, she plans to achieve her goal of sharing and creating art for others -- a dream she has had since the start.
